समुद्रलङ्घनारम्भः — Commencement of the Ocean-Crossing

चामीकरमहानाभ देवगन्धर्वसेवित।।।।हनुमांस्त्वयि विश्रान्तस्ततः शेषं गमिष्यति।

cāmīkaramahānābha devagandharvasevita | hanumān tvayi viśrāntas tataḥ śeṣaṃ gamiṣyati ||

O golden-peaked one, frequented by gods and Gandharvas—when Hanumān has rested upon you, he will then go on to cover the remaining distance.

"O golden-peaked mountain!you are the refuge of the gods and gandharvas. Let him also rest on you for a while before he negotiates the remaining part of the journey.

Sustaining the righteous: dharma includes enabling a worthy person to complete their vow by offering timely rest and refuge.

Samudra reassures Maināka that Hanumān will rest briefly and then proceed to finish the ocean-crossing.

Supportive cooperation: different beings coordinate their roles so a truthful, dharmic objective can be fulfilled.
